May 1, 2016Simultaneously the best and most hated album of 2013. This polarizing, meticulous and grand follow up to his masterpiece, "My Beautiful Dark Twisted Fantasy", is relentlessly challenging to listeners and will instantly turn you off from the first track. However it is something you need to stick with and embrace its view and it pays off hugely.

Mar 22, 201676/100. Kanye put out a really interesting album here, and it is carried by a few songs, but held down by others. "On Sight" and "I Am a God" are two of the worst songs Kanye has ever put out, while "Hold My Liquor", "I'm In It", "Blood on the Leaves" and "Bound 2" are among the best. You get a mixed bag with this album, but overall it has enough great songs to make it a good album.

The WireDec 10, 2013His concerns are serious--consumerism, race, fame, relationships--but he rarely addresses them with the craft or focus they deserve. [Sep 2013, p.66]
-
Q MagazineAug 20, 2013Contradiction incarnate, Yeezus is Kanye's most Kanyeish LP yet. [Sep 2013, p.103]
-
MojoAug 13, 2013Nasty, brutish, short, and wholly compelling, Yeezus begs only one question: where next? [Sep 2013, p.89]
